Description
This book introduces the theories and methods of Nature-Inspired Robotics in artificial intelligence.
Software and hardware technologies, alongside theories and methods, illustrate the application of bio-inspired artificial intelligence.
It includes discussions on topics such as Robot Control Manipulators, Geometric Transformation, Robotic Drive Systems and Nature Inspired Robotic Neural System.
Elaborating upon recent progress made in five distinct configurations of nature-inspired computing, it explores the potential applications of this technology in two specific areas: neuromorphic computing systems and neuromorphic perceptual systems. · Discusses advances in cutting-edge technology in brain-inspired computing, perception technologies and aspects of neuromorphic electronics· Offers a thorough introduction to two-terminal neuromorphic memristors, including memristive devices and resistive switching mechanisms· Provides comprehensive explorations of spintronic neuromorphic devices and multi-terminal neuromorphic devices with cognitive behaviours· Includes cognitive behaviour of Inspired Robotics and cognitive technologies with applications in Artificial Intelligence· Contains practical discussions of neuromorphic devices based on chalcogenide and organic materials. This text acts as a reference book for students, scholars, and industry professionals.
